“Youth Of May” Hits Another Personal Best In Viewership Ratings
KBS’s “Youth of May” is seeing slow but steady progress upward in viewership ratings. According to Nielsen Korea, the May 25 episode of “Youth of May” garnered average nationwide ratings of 4.3 and 5.7 percent. ENHYPEN Debuts In Top 20 Of Billboard 200 With “BORDER : CARNIVAL”
ENHYPEN has entered the Billboard 200 charts for the first time! For the week ending on May 29, ENHYPEN’s latest EP “BORDER : CARNIVAL,” debuted at No. 18 on Billboard’s Top 200 Albums chart—its weekly ranking of the most popular albums in the United States.
